  As the South Dakota State Fair was opening on this Wednesday morning—Candi Briley who has been helping us for months count  it down gave us a look at what to expect---today, Thursday, Friday, Saturday and Sunday.
   We have truly appreciated the fact we could follow along with the clock updates and all getting ready for the start.
   Today –Candi talked about all the activities---gave some idea of how to get to the Fair Grounds—and once you got there—what to expect. It is a special year—a day has been added—there is plenty of anticipation for the events---and we know that our residents and visitors will be joining us---as well as the news media providing some coverage. 
    Veterans Day on Thursday-----and vets get tickets to get in. Friday---we’ll be live from the Fairgrounds from 9 to 11---and look to engage again with the fun and the learning experiences people of all ages will see. A big crowd will be expected—weather support to be good----Saturday----is the Farmers Union lunch ---that costs those attending less than 50 cents—but would be $12 or so if you bought it over the counter. Food is key to agriculture in South Dakota and we appreciate what South Dakota Farmers Union---and the South Dakota Farm Bureau do for those in Ag---and the youngsters growing up.     Bryson Patterson—SBA of South Dakota was with us a second straight day at the Lincoln Covery Center---flooding help is available---and we are hearing they finally shut down those in Northwest Iowa—but just opened the one here. We know there are people hurting from the flooding. Congressman Dusty Johnson encouraged people to check in and see if there is help available.
   We heard from Mike Smart—author of the Bucket Buddies Series—background in gardening, homeschooling his own kids and character design---aiming to inspire children and families to embrace eco friendly gardening. Building a Town Garden has a background in Ag –what he is doing and how people jump on—the book is live today—available at all major book stores thru Amazon and Barnes and Noble as well as available direct at Smart Farms Global. 
   He moved here from Washington State and his experience in Colton---shares there isn’t a grocery store there---he is trying to give people a chance to visit and find a way to grow their own food indoors. Sounds like fun and there are a lot of Colton communities around South Dakota.
